Lincoln Carpenter - Shadows of Doubt, the procgen private-eye immersive sim, is leaving early access next month - pcgamer.com

Shadows of Doubt, the procgen private-eye immersive sim, is leaving early access next month

When Shadows of Doubt hit early access last April, we quickly became believers in the potential of its procedurally generated cities and crime solving simulation sandbox. After 17 months of improvements, additions, and tune-ups, we'll see how well that potential's been realized when the cyberpunk detective sim gets its 1.0 release on September 26, 2024.

Michael Myers - John Carpenter Is Working On The First Halloween Video Game In 30 Years - screenrant.com

John Carpenter Is Working On The First Halloween Video Game In 30 Years

Michael Myers may have slashed his way through Hollywood but now he's stalking a different form of entertainment in a new official video game. Despite having a major impact on genre filmmaking and establishing a devoted fanbase, hasn't made a dent in the video game industry; in fact, the franchise has only received one interactive adaptation in the form of the self-titled 1983 game for the Atari 2600. That's about to change as legendary filmmaker and series creator John Carpenter is working to bring Michael to consoles.
